Prince Harry Loses U.K. Security Appeal, Says Return Home Is ‘Impossible’ Without Protection

Prince Harry says it is “impossible” to bring his family back to the U.K. safely after losing a legal appeal to restore full police protection. The British Home Office ruled in 2020 that Harry, who stepped down from royal duties, would no longer receive automatic high-level security—an outcome he called “pretty gutted about” in a BBC interview.

Harry criticized the ruling, upheld by the Court of Appeal, and urged Prime Minister Keir Starmer and Home Secretary Yvette Cooper to reconsider. He argued that his royal identity and high-profile status still make him a target, citing threats from groups like al-Qaeda and a dangerous paparazzi incident in New York in 2023.

Although he expressed hopes of reconciling with his family, Harry claimed King Charles “won’t speak to me because of this security stuff.” He emphasized that his royal status “can’t change,” comparing his situation to other public figures who retain protection post-service.

The case comes amid a broader rift with the royal family, detailed in Harry’s memoir Spare and a Netflix documentary. He and Meghan Markle, who now live in California with their two children, stepped back from royal duties in 2020, citing racism and lack of palace support.
